Summary

The Quality Assurance (QA) Manager is responsible for leading the QA team in its role of reviewing and improving the quality of work created by various departments within PRI’s Federal No Surprises Act Independent Dispute Resolution Entity (IDRE). The QA Manager supervises a team of QA Analysts and a QA Team Lead as they review a large quantity of decisions by other IDRE teams, provides feedback to those teams, reports on overall quality metrics, and creates systemic improvements to IDRE processes and training to improve quality. The QA Manager develops policies & procedures, coaches QA team members, spearheads special projects, reports up to senior IDRE management, and is responsible for identifying training needs and developing training for the IDRE team.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Manage and develop a team of QA Analysts and QA Team Leads that report directly to the QA Manager. Participate in QA Analyst work as needed to meet the department’s goals.
  • Assess and measure team performance, provide feedback, coach, and write reviews.
  • Take ownership of Quality Assurance key performance metrics including productivity, quality, accuracy, reporting, and development of policy and training opportunities.
  • Help scale the department by assisting with hiring and improving process efficiency to allow the QA team members to increase their productivity.
  • Spearhead special projects to investigate quality trends and improve outcomes, both as requested by IDRE leadership and by taking initiative.
  • Proactively manage the timeliness and accuracy of reporting from the QA department.
  • Interface with members of other IDRE teams to investigate trends, provide feedback, answer questions, and coach personnel. Maintain a professional, collegial, and productive relationship.
  • Keep up to date on CMS policies relating to the Federal No Surprises Act IDR process. Understand CMS guidelines and regulations at a high level and proactively learn about changes in policy and changes in stakeholder behavior.
  • Keep the QA team aligned with IDRE Senior Management decisions and direction.
  • Interact with external stakeholders in the government and private sector in a professional and accountable manner as a representative of PRI management.
  • Assist with daily operations across the PRI IDRE team as needed.
  • Proactively participate in ISO and Continuous Quality Improvement activities.
  • Perform other duties as required.
